ne bis in idem’ principle, which prohibits duplication of proceedings for same acts, can preclude arrest of a person who is subject of an Interpol notice
Brussels, 12/05/2021 (Agence Europe)

The Court of Justice of the EU ruled, on Wednesday 12 May (Case C-505/19), that the ‘ne bis in idem’ principle, which prohibits the duplication of proceedings for the same acts, may preclude the arrest, in the Schengen area and in the EU, of a person who is subject of an Interpol notice.
